本文目录导读:
随着大数据、云计算等技术的飞速发展,分布式存储系统已成为企业数据中心不可或缺的核心组件,本文将从分布式存储解决方案出发,详细探讨分布式存储配置的关键策略,旨在帮助读者优化存储性能与可靠性。
分布式存储概述
分布式存储是一种将数据分散存储在多个节点上的存储方式,通过分布式文件系统或分布式数据库实现数据的并行访问和处理,相较于传统的集中式存储,分布式存储具有以下优势:
1、高可用性:分布式存储系统通过冗余机制,保证数据不因单点故障而丢失。
图片来源于网络,如有侵权联系删除
2、高性能:分布式存储系统通过并行处理,提高数据读写速度。
3、高扩展性:分布式存储系统可按需扩展,满足不断增长的数据存储需求。
分布式存储配置关键策略
1、节点选择
节点选择是分布式存储配置的首要任务,以下为节点选择的关键因素:
(1)硬件性能:选择具有较高CPU、内存和磁盘性能的节点,以确保存储系统的高性能。
(2)网络带宽:确保节点间网络带宽充足,降低数据传输延迟。
(3)存储容量:根据存储需求,选择具有足够存储容量的节点。
(4)冗余设计:采用冗余设计,提高系统可用性。
2、存储协议选择
分布式存储系统支持多种存储协议,如NFS、iSCSI、CIFS等,以下为选择存储协议的关键因素:
(1)兼容性:选择与现有系统兼容的存储协议。
图片来源于网络,如有侵权联系删除
(2)性能:根据存储需求,选择性能较好的存储协议。
(3)安全性:选择支持数据加密、访问控制等安全机制的存储协议。
3、数据分布策略
数据分布策略直接影响存储系统的性能与可靠性,以下为常见的数据分布策略:
(1)均匀分布:将数据均匀分配到各个节点,提高系统性能。
(2)轮询分布:按顺序将数据分配到各个节点,简化数据恢复过程。
(3)一致性哈希:根据数据哈希值,将数据分配到节点,提高系统扩展性。
4、存储冗余设计
存储冗余设计是保证数据可靠性的关键,以下为常见的存储冗余设计:
(1)数据复制:将数据复制到多个节点,确保数据不因单点故障而丢失。
(2)数据校验:对数据进行校验,确保数据一致性。
图片来源于网络,如有侵权联系删除
(3)数据恢复:制定数据恢复策略,确保数据在故障后能够快速恢复。
5、存储性能优化
以下为存储性能优化的关键策略:
(1)缓存机制:采用缓存机制,提高数据读写速度。
(2)负载均衡:实现负载均衡,避免单点过载。
(3)数据压缩:对数据进行压缩,降低存储空间占用。
(4)数据去重:对数据进行去重,减少存储空间占用。
分布式存储配置是构建高性能、高可靠性的存储系统的重要环节,通过合理选择节点、存储协议、数据分布策略、存储冗余设计以及存储性能优化,可有效提高分布式存储系统的性能与可靠性,在实际应用中,还需根据具体需求进行调整和优化,以满足不断增长的数据存储需求。
标签: #分布式存储配置
评论列表